According to Wikipedia, sea squirts are "marine filter feeders with a saclike morphology. In their respiration and feeding they take in water through an incurrent (or inhalant) siphon and expel the filtered water through an excurrent (or exhalant) siphon."  To me they look like the water tentacle from James Cameron's great film, The Abyss:
